Title: Gregory B Huntington: Innovator in Fabric Treatment Technologies
Introduction
Gregory B Huntington is a notable inventor based in Cincinnati, OH (US), recognized for his contributions to the field of fabric treatment technologies. He holds a total of 3 patents that showcase his innovative approach to improving laundry processes and fabric care.
Latest Patents
Huntington's latest patents include a unique detergent tablets-package combination. This invention features a packaging system that incorporates re-closing means with a stack of tablets containing a bleaching agent that is unstable in a moisture environment. The packaging device is characterized by a Moisture Vapor Transfer Rate of less than 20 g/m²/day, measured at 40°C and 75% eRH, to prevent water ingress. Additionally, the packaging system may include a micro-hole to allow for gas release.
Another significant patent involves articles and methods for treating fabrics. This innovation focuses on dryer-added fabric conditioning articles and methods that utilize a fabric softener agent and a polymeric soil release agent. Specifically, damp fabrics are mixed with softener active and polymeric soil release agents during the drying operation, providing soil release benefits concurrently with drying. The softening and antistatic soil release agents are preferably used in combination with a dispensing means designed for automatic dryers.
